What is a common ancestor?

Answer 2
Answer: A Common ancestor is a organism that has shared predecessor of more then one different scion of a group of organisms.

When a reaction occurs between atoms with ground state electron configuration 1s2 2s1 and 1s2 2s2 2p5 the predominant type of bond formed is

Answers

Answer:

Ionic

Explanation:

Step 1: Define

1s²2s¹ is Lithium (Li)

1s²2s²2p⁵ is Chlorine (Cl)

Step 2: RxN

2Li (s) + Cl₂ (g) → 2LiCl (s)

Step 3: Identify

LiCl is a metal and a non-metal bonded together. Therefore, it will be an ionic bond. The Lithium would transfer it's electron to Chlorine (since it wants a full outer shell 0f 8 and it currently as 7) and form a salt.
